Load the config file#

Configuration_file = 'Configurations/config_3D_ROM_pretrained_KSV.toml'

with open(Configuration_file, mode="rb") as file:
    config = tomllib.load(file)

Definition of the space domain and mechanical proprieties of the structure#

The initial Material parameters, the geometry, mesh and the boundary conditions are set.

# Load pretrained model dictionnary and get the corresponding mesh size to build an empty equivalent model

trained_dict = torch.load('Pretrained_models/'+config["training"]["PreviousModel"], weights_only=False)
config["interpolation"]["MaxElemSize2D"] = trained_dict["Space_modes.0.h_max"].item()


# Material parameters definition

Mat = pre.Material(             flag_lame = False,                                  # If True should input lmbda and mu instead of E and nu
                                coef1     = config["material"]["E"],                # Young Modulus
                                coef2     = config["material"]["nu"]                # Poisson's ratio
                )

# Create mesh object
MaxElemSize = pre.ElementSize(
                                dimension     = config["interpolation"]["dimension"],
                                L             = config["geometry"]["L"],
                                order         = config["interpolation"]["order"],
                                np            = config["interpolation"]["np"],
                                MaxElemSize2D = config["interpolation"]["MaxElemSize2D"]
                            )
Excluded = []
Mesh_object = pre.Mesh( 
                                config["geometry"]["Name"],                         # Create the mesh object
                                MaxElemSize, 
                                config["interpolation"]["order"], 
                                config["interpolation"]["dimension"]
                        )

Mesh_object.AddBorders(config["Borders"]["Borders"])
Mesh_object.AddBCs(                                                                 # Include Boundary physical domains infos (BCs+volume)
                                config["geometry"]["Volume_element"],
                                Excluded,
                                config["DirichletDictionryList"]
                    )                   

Mesh_object.MeshGeo()                                                               # Mesh the .geo file if .msh does not exist
Mesh_object.ReadMesh()       
Mesh_object.ExportMeshVtk()
 
 
   _   _            ____   ___  __  __ 
  | \ | | ___ _   _|  _ \ / _ \|  \/  |
  |  \| |/ _ \ | | | |_) | | | | |\/| |
  | |\  |  __/ |_| |  _ <| |_| | |  | |
  |_| \_|\___|\__,_|_| \_\ ___/|_|  |_|

                  3.1.2

************ MESH READING COMPLETE ************

 * Dimension of the problem: 3D
 * Elements type:            4-node tetrahedron
 * Number of Dofs:           52137

Pyvista plots#

Plot the solution and the error with regard to the Finite Element solution

E_vect = [0.1, 0.1, 0.075]
theta_vect = [1.57, 4.81, 4.81]



error_vect = []
for i in range(len(E_vect)):

    num_displ_file = "GroundTruth/nodal_num_displacement_nonlinear_E="+str(E_vect[i])+"_theta="+str(theta_vect[i])+".npy"

    # eval_coord =  torch.tensor(np.load(eval_coord_file), dtype=torch.float64, requires_grad=True)
    Nodes = np.stack(Mesh_object.Nodes)  

    eval_coord = torch.tensor(Nodes[:,1:])#DEBUG

    num_displ = torch.tensor(np.load(num_displ_file))

    theta = torch.tensor([theta_vect[i]],dtype=torch.float64)
    theta = theta[:,None] 

    # E = torch.tensor([E_vect[i]],dtype=torch.float64)
    E = torch.tensor([E_vect[i]],dtype=torch.float64)
    E = E[:,None] 


    Para_coord_list = nn.ParameterList((E,theta))
    ROM_model.eval()                                                        # Put model in evaluation mode
    u_sol = ROM_model(eval_coord,Para_coord_list)                           # Evaluate model

    u_sol_x = u_sol[0,:,0,0]
    u_sol_y = u_sol[1,:,0,0]

    u_ref_x = num_displ[:,0]
    u_ref_y = num_displ[:,1]

    u_ref_tot = torch.hstack((u_ref_x,u_ref_y))
    u_sol_tot = torch.hstack((u_sol_x,u_sol_y))

    error_u_tot = (torch.linalg.vector_norm(u_sol_tot - u_ref_tot)/torch.linalg.vector_norm(u_ref_tot)).item()
    error_vect.append(error_u_tot)
error_vect
[0.01056128743112179, 0.006306893696049836, 0.006287185992579424]
